Youth Climate Action Fund

Empowering young people to take action and build a greener future for Glasgow

The Youth Climate Action Fund (YCAF) is a programme supporting young people aged 15 to 24 to design and lead climate-focused projects across Glasgow.

Funded by Bloomberg Philanthropies and delivered by Glasgow City Council and the Centre for Civic Innovation, the YCAF provides grants up to £3,500 to young people and youth-focused organisations to encourage grassroots environmental action.

Marking Glasgow's third year of the fund, the 2026 programme will support young people to bring their ideas to life and play an active role in shaping positive change within their communities, while gaining confidence and experience, building valuable skills for the future, and making connections along the way.



2025 Funding

There were 20 projects funded in 2025 covering a range of different activities, from food growing and outdoor learning to green careers field trips, storytelling and live performances to nature-based art therapy initiatives. Each of the projects funded align with goals and ambitions of Glasgow's Climate Plan

In addition to their focus on climate change, the projects also had a strong focus on health and wellbeing, co-design and creative methods, youth voice and confidence building, skills development and creating future opportunities for young people.

Kick-Off Event

To kick off the 2025 programme, we brought together all funded projects for a launch event to support participants to connect, collaborate and shape the journey ahead. The event provided an opportunity for project teams to get to know each other, share ideas and start building a network of young changemakers.

In response to feedback from previous participants about creating opportunities to connect with their peers, we set up an exhibition space where each project could showcase their work. This encouraged conversations, sparked new ideas and helped teams build valuable relationships from the beginning.

Planting Seeds

Planting Seeds is a webinar series designed to inspire people of all ages to turn challenges into opportunities and transform ideas into meaningful action. Through conversations with innovators, changemakers and experts from a range of fields, the series explores how small actions can spark positive change in communities and beyond.

Throughout 2025, we welcomed guest speakers who shared their experiences, insights and practical advice, helping to inspire young people participating in the Youth Climate Action Fund and support them with developing their projects and future aspirations.

Celebration Event

We rounded off the 2025 programme with an event to celebrate the creativity, passion and dedication of young people. Participants came together to share their projects, reflect on their achievements and showcase the positive impact they had made.

Local organisations and experts were also invited to be part of the event, creating opportunities for young people to make new connections and explore future opportunities. As well as celebrating what had been achieved throughout the year, the event also highlighted the potential of young people to lead meaningful climate action.
